I was a quiet boy with loud dreams. But dreams don’t grow well in a house full of fear.
As a gay child in a home where silence meant survival, I learned to vanish. For years, I kept my voice hidden – not just from the world, but from myself.
Then came music. Drag. Glitter. Applause.
And, for a time, freedom. Onstage, I could be someone bigger than the pain. For twenty years, I sang and performed my way into pieces of joy I never thought I’d know.
But trauma has its own rhythm.
In the quiet of the covid years, the past came roaring back. I lost my voice again – this time to adulthood pain, depression, and the unhealed echoes of my childhood. Stillness and Survival is a story of silence and expression, queerness and survival, collapse and return. It is about finding your own voice – again and again – even when the world tries to take it away.
This is not just a memoir.
It’s a reclaiming.
